Python Pep8 检查工具
Sublime Text 2 插件 / 检查 Python 文件是否符合 PEP8 的一些风格约定
标签 linting
详细信息
安装次数
- 总数 16K
- Win 5K
- Mac 6K
- Linux 5K
2021 年 8 月 6 日 | 2021 年 8 月 5 日 | 2021 年 8 月 4 日 | 2021 年 8 月 3 日 | 2021 年 8 月 2 日 | 2021 年 8 月 1 日 | 2021 年 7 月 31 日 | 2021 年 7 月 30 日 | 2021 年 7 月 29 日 | 2021 年 7 月 28 日 | 2021 年 7 月 27 日 | 2021 年 7 月 26 日 | 2021 年 7 月 25 日 | 2021 年 7 月 24 日 | 2021 年 7 月 23 日 | 2021 年 7 月 22 日 | 2021 年 7 月 21 日 | 2021 年 7 月 20 日 | 2021 年 7 月 19 日 | 2021 年 7 月 18 日 | 2021 年 7 月 17 日 | 2021 年 7 月 16 日 | 2021 年 7 月 15 日 | 2021 年 7 月 14 日 | 2021 年 7 月 13 日 | 2021 年 7 月 12 日 | 2021 年 7 月 11 日 | 2021 年 7 月 10 日 | 2021 年 7 月 9 日 | 2021 年 7 月 8 日 | 2021 年 7 月 7 日 | 2021 年 7 月 6 日 | 2021 年 7 月 5 日 | 2021 年 7 月 4 日 | 2021 年 7 月 3 日 | 2021 年 7 月 2 日 | 2021 年 7 月 1 日 | 2021 年 6 月 30 日 | 2021 年 6 月 29 日 | 2021 年 6 月 28 日 | 2021 年 6 月 27 日 | 2021 年 6 月 26 日 | 2021 年 6 月 25 日 | 2021 年 6 月 24 日 | 2021 年 6 月 23 日 |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Windows |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Mac |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
Linux |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 | 0 |
自述文件
这是一个新的、更强大的用于检查 Python 文件的插件:[github.com/dreadatour/Flake8Lint](https://github.com/dreadatour/Flake8Lint)
Flake8Lint 包含 pep8 lind 和 pyflakes lind - 请使用它。
Pep8Lint
Pep8Lint 是一个 Sublime Text 2 插件,用于检查 Python 文件是否符合 PEP8 的一些风格约定。
安装
从 GitHub 下载最新源码,并将 Pep8Lint 文件夹复制到你的 ST2 “ Packages” 目录。
或者克隆仓库到你的 ST2 “ Packages” 目录
git clone git://github.com/dreadatour/Pep8Lint.git
“ Packages” 目录位于
OS X
~/Library/Application Support/Sublime Text 2/Packages/
Linux
~/.config/sublime-text-2/Packages/
Windows
%APPDATA%/Sublime Text 2/Packages/
配置
默认 Pep8Lint 配置: “首选项” -> “包设置” -> “Pep8Lint” -> “设置 - 默认”
{
// run pep8 lint on file saving
"lint_on_save": true,
// set maximum line length
"max-line-length": 79,
// select errors and warnings (e.g. ["E", "W6"])
"select": [],
//skip errors and warnings (e.g. ["E303", E4", "W"])
"ignore": [],
// Visual settings
// display popup with errors
"popup": true,
// highlight errors
"highlight": false
}
要更改默认设置,请转到“首选项” -> “包设置” -> “Pep8Lint” -> “设置 - 用户”并将默认配置粘贴到打开的文件中。
特性/用法
自动使用 pep8 lint 工具检查 Python 文件,并显示错误列表窗口
并且在选择时跳转到错误行/字符。